From the Oct/Nov 2011 issue French Magazine became FrenchEntrée Magazine. With our website receiving close to 200,000 international visitors every month it made sense for us to bring the two brands together. Apart from the change to the logo it's business as usual: the same team will be bringing you the same beautiful magazine dedicated to French culture, property and lifestyle.
Following a successful launch in Bristol, our fashion community MyStreetChic.com is rolling out to UK cities from Autumn 2011. The site focusses on real girls and real fashion, helping people interpret the latest high street fashions trends in their own way.
